GERMANY’S CRUSHING RATES.

LONDON, March 6. Communal rates in Germany, which are based on income tax, have been increased enormously. The pre-war rate was 105 per cent, of income-tax, and the post-war 1914 was 189 per cent. In 1915 it rose to 199 per cent., and is now 216 pel’ cent.
